RUSTON – Louisiana Tech held a one-goal lead going into the second half, but New Mexico State netted two goals in the final 15 minutes to come out on top, 2-1, on Sunday afternoon at Robert Mack Caruthers Field.
Â
LA Tech (2-9-5, 0-6-2 CUSA) played stellar defense in the first half, allowing only one shot by NM State (10-5-2, 5-2-1 CUSA). And on offense, the Bulldogs capitalized on a free kick to go up 1-0 at the 18-minute mark.
Â
Senior
Tomoyo Kuroyanagi sent the ball into the box where he was deflected by two Aggie defender before finding the foot of
Kyra Taylor. The sophomore planted the one-touch finish into the low left corner for the goal.
Â
The one-goal lead lasted all the way up to the 75th minute when NM State equalized with Loma McNeese scoring off a tough angle on the right side from 20 yards out.
Â
The match seemed destined by a draw, but the Aggies took the lead in the 88th minute. Senior Sarah Melen was able to make a diving save on a shot attempt, but the rebound was put in by Milana Eyrich.
Â
LA Tech had a 16-11 shot advantage in the match and a 7-3 corner kick advantage. Taylor had a team-high four shots while seniors
Kalli Matlock,
Tal Faingezicht, and Kuroyanagi combined for seven shots.
Â
The senior Melen registered five saves in the loss.
